Output e078773f0579638fc16e0267533272d53d77ec18c2f74bfba2a391a9afe22c8c:8

value
43629189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a5bfd55601d19855c663ec99b9ebe7b1bc9ebb OP_EQUAL
address
398jDYn2P2TLYFCnQfotB8XX9cZsnD5QeV
transaction
e078773f0579638fc16e0267533272d53d77ec18c2f74bfba2a391a9afe22c8c
spent
true